Transaction 31e7e859ff40741ffa92f78e12d95846950b692e33afa8360ee66178c2e5147b
1 Input
2 Outputs
- 31e7e859ff40741ffa92f78e12d95846950b692e33afa8360ee66178c2e5147b:0
- 31e7e859ff40741ffa92f78e12d95846950b692e33afa8360ee66178c2e5147b:1
value 334534
address 16wdZKN8ddd1ZWh2KFs14QBewW9EhYcmDY
value 2674721
address 37pcY7Fuv5UppAHC7NeF67V7aQtjUYuSsF